Gateway Classic Cars is proud in presenting this 1941 Willys Coupe at the Milwaukee Showroom. Willys has been better known for their production of the earlier Jeeps prior to Jeep becoming a trademarked name, but before that the Americar had debuted in 1937 being one of a very few civilian coupes they made in their existence. The Americar had gone through some transformations in styling to where it began to resemble the Ford Deluxe by the time 1940 rolled around. The fact that these cars came equipped with the 60hp “Go Devil 4-cylinder engine that suffered a lot of engine failures made it a prime target for enthusiasts to turn these into top notch customized hot rods. Gateway Classic Cars of Louisville is proud to present this 1949 Chevrolet C30 C.O.E.! After World War II Chevrolet was looking to revitalize their aging AK Series of trucks and brought the new Advance Design to the market. The Advance Design series brought forth a new look that was well received and sales were strong. This series would see production from 1947-1955. Here we have a 49 model and a C30 model C.O.E. Gateway Classic Cars of Milwaiukee is excited to present this 1972 De Tomaso Pantera . The De Tomaso is a mid-engine Italian sports car manufactured from 1971 to 1993. The word Pantera is Italian for Panther. The car debuted in 1970, but the first produced De-Tomasos were built in 1971 at a rate of three cars per day in the early production. In late 1971, Ford began importing the Pantera for the American Market. A Total of 1007 cars reached the United States in the first year of production. Gateway Classic Cars is proud to offer this beautiful addition to our Philadelphia showroom, a striking 1966 Oldsmobile 4-4-2 at our showroom located in West Deptford, NJ! With competition coming from all directions, Oldsmobile came out strong with the introduction of the 4-4-2! While it was a worthy competitor, the 4-4-2 fell short of cubic inches and the straight-line performance seen in cars like the GTO and Chevelle. To answer the call, Oldsmobile prepared a new 400 engine in 1965 and revamped the 4-4-2 package with simulated rear fender scoops and colorful 4-4-2 badges. Thanks to these changes, Oldsmobile saw significant success in their sales and were looking forward to the 1966 model year. Powering this incredible machine is the numbers matching 400 CID V8, rebuilt 300 miles ago, equipped with the legendary Track Pac, an over-the-counter Tri-Carb conversion kit that boosted power from 350 to 360 horsepower! Perhaps the coolest part of the engine bay is the Outside Air Induction package (OAI). The OAI features dual air scoops that are incorporated in the front bumpers which interestingly forced the relocation of the front turn-signals. To make room for the scoops, the factory moved the turn signals in about a foot! You wont see this on your average Olds!
